Chamber names 2017 Leadership Wichita class

The Wichita Regional Chamber of Commerce announced Tuesday its 2017 Leadership Wichita class.

The 33 people selected to this year’s class will attend eight sessions between late August and early November learning about economic and workforce development, leadership skills and other topics that will equip them to be the area’s future leaders.

The selections were made based on nominations to the program’s board of trustees.

“Past participants of Leadership Wichita have made significant contributions in our community, and this year’s class will graduate equipped with the insight to build upon their professional successes to make Wichita the premier place to grow companies, careers and communities,” Tyler Heffron, chair of Leadership Wichita’s trustees, said in a news release.
